Securities issues, October 2021

Borrowing in foreign currency decreased

Statistical news from Statistics Sweden 2021-11-17 9.30

At the end of October, total liabilities in Swedish debt securities amounted to SEK 8 591 billion, down by SEK 66 billion from September. This decrease is mainly due to decreased borrowing in debt securities denominated in foreign currency.

Developments in October 2021 in brief

Decreased liabilities in securities denominated in euros and US dollars

  • In October, liabilities in securities denominated in foreign currency decreased by SEK 165 billion.
  • Borrowing in debt securities denominated in euros amounted to SEK 1 833 billion at the end of October, down by SEK 72 billion from the previous month.
  • For securities denominated in US dollars, liabilities amounted to SEK 1 270 billion, down by SEK 78 billion compared with the end of September.
  • The annual growth rate for total securities liabilities was 4.5 percent, down by 1.0 percentage point compared with September.

Less borrowing from monetary financial institutions

  • In October, monetary financial institutions decreased liabilities in unsecured securities by SEK 101 billion.
  • This decrease in unsecured securities originates primarily from money market instruments, in which the debt stock decreased by SEK 86 billion. Of the decrease in the debt stock, SEK 55 billion was denominated in US dollars.
  • In terms of secured securities, monetary financial institutions increased the debt stock by SEK 28 billion.
  • The increase in secured securities originates exclusively from bonds, in which borrowing in securities denominated in Swedish kronor increased by SEK 47 billion, while it decreased by SEK 18 billion for bonds denominated in foreign currency.

Maturity structure

  • Securities valued at SEK 2 065 billion will reach maturity within six months. Money market instruments and bonds account for SEK 1 455 billion and SEK 610 billion of these respectively.
  • Within six months, securities denominated in euros valued at SEK 285 billion and securities denominated in US dollars valued at SEK 631 billion will reach maturity.

Definitions and explanations

Contents of this publication

Statistics Sweden’s monthly publication on Securities issues covers total outstanding volume and maturity structure for debt securities issued by Swedish issuers. It describes the development and conditions of Swedish enterprises’ debt securities borrowing.
